The cheapest way to get from Busselton to Armadale is to bus which costs $30 - $50 and takes 3h 32m.
The fastest way to get from Busselton to Armadale is to drive which takes 2h 21m and costs $35 - $55.
No, there is no direct bus from Busselton to Armadale. However, there are services departing from Busselton and arriving at Armadale Stn Stand 1 via Cockburn Stn Stand 9.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 32m.
The distance between Busselton and Armadale is 219 km. The road distance is 199 km.
The best way to get from Busselton to Armadale without a car is to bus which takes 3h 32m and costs $30 - $50.
It takes approximately 3h 32m to get from Busselton to Armadale, including transfers.
Busselton to Armadale bus services, operated by South West Coach Lines, depart from Busselton station.
Busselton to Armadale bus services, operated by South West Coach Lines, arrive at Cockburn Central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Busselton to Armadale is 199 km. It takes approximately 2h 21m to drive from Busselton to Armadale.

What companies run services between Busselton, WA, Australia and Armadale, WA, Australia?
South West Coach Lines operates a bus from Busselton to Cockburn Central Station 3 times a day. Tickets cost $28–40 and the journey takes 2h 45m. Transwa also services this route once daily.
